1. A wheel of radius 0.2 m starts from rest at t = 0 and rotates with constant angular acceleration about its axis to an angular velocity of 12 rad/s at t = 3 s.What is the angular acceleration of the wheel?
(a) 4 rad/s2(b) 15 rad/s2(c) 7.2 rad/s2(d) 36 rad/s2(e) 1.33 rad/s22. How many revolutions does the wheel make during the period of acceleration?
(a) 2.9(b) 3.7(c) 1.5(d) 8.6(e) 6.93. At t = 1.5 s, what is the centripetal acceleration of a point on the rim of the wheel?
(a) 4 m/s2(b) 15 m/s2(c) 7.2 m/s2(d) 36 m/s2(e) 1.33 m/s2
